Apéndice A. Instalación de Kafka en otros sistemas operativos

Apache Kafka es principalmente una aplicación Java y, por tanto, debería poder ejecutarse en cualquier sistema en el que puedas instalar un JRE. Sin embargo, se ha optimizado para sistemas operativos basados en Linux, por lo que es allí donde funcionará mejor. Ejecutarlo en otros sistemas operativos puede dar lugar a errores específicos del sistema operativo. Por esta razón, cuando utilices Kafka con fines de desarrollo o prueba en un sistema operativo de escritorio común, es una buena idea considerar la posibilidad de ejecutarlo en una máquina virtual que coincida con tu eventual entorno de producción.

Instalación en Windows

A partir de Microsoft Windows 10, ahora hay dos formas de ejecutar Kafka. La forma tradicional es utilizando una instalación nativa de Java. Los usuarios de Windows 10 también tienen la opción de utilizar el Subsistema de Windows para Linux. Este último método es el preferido porque proporciona una configuración mucho más sencilla que se ajusta más al entorno de producción típico, por lo que lo revisaremos en primer lugar.

Utilizar el subsistema Windows para Linux

Si utilizas Windows 10, puedes instalar la compatibilidad nativa con Ubuntu en Windows mediante el Subsistema de Windows para Linux (WSL). En el momento de la publicación, Microsoft todavía considera que WSL es una función experimental. Aunque actúa de forma similar a una máquina virtual, no requiere los recursos de una VM completa ...

Get Kafka: La Guía Definitiva, 2ª Edición now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.